Ошибка набора пути платформы ZendGdata


Здравствуйте я использую фреймворк ZendGdata-1.12.5 для загрузки видео на youtube

В моем php коде я использовал следующее

$path = './ZendGdata-1.12.5/library/';
set_include_path(get_include_path() . PATH_SEPARATOR . $path);

require_once('Zend/Loader.php');  

Zend_Loader::loadClass('Zend_Gdata');  
Zend_Loader::loadClass('Zend_Gdata_YouTube');  
Zend_Loader::loadClass('Zend_Gdata_AuthSub');  
Zend_Loader::loadClass('Zend_Gdata_ClientLogin');  
Но, кажется, ничего не работает ! помочь ?

Предупреждение PHP: require_once(Zend / Xml / Security.php): не удалось открыть поток: нет такого файла или каталога в в /var/www в/youtube_upload_video/ZendGdata-1.12.5/библиотека/Зенд/антивируса Avast/приложение/базу.РНР в строке 30

PHP фатальная ошибка: require_once (): требуется неудачное открытие - Zend / Xml / Security.на PHP' (в include_path='.:/usr/доли/в PHP:/usr/доли/груша:./ZendGdata-1.12.5 / библиотека/') в в /var/www в/youtube_upload_video/ZendGdata-1.12.5/библиотека/Зенд/антивируса Avast/приложение/базу.РНР в строке 30

1 3

1 ответ:

Путь правильный, проблема в том, что библиотека Zend Gdata не имеет папки Zend/xml. Это небольшая папка с 2 файлами. Все, что вам нужно сделать, это следующее:

1) Перейти к: http://framework.zend.com/downloads/latest

2) Загрузите минимальный пакет 1.12 (или какой бы ни была ваша версия). 3) извлеките его на жесткий диск. 4) загрузите папку /library/Zend/Xml в папку /ZendGdata-1.12.5/library/ вашего сервера, чтобы в папке /ZendGdata-1.12.5/library/Zend у вас была папка Xml.

5) Вот и все. Наслаждаться.